Připojení k netu přes GPRS

Ahoj,mam dotaz.Přemýšlel jsem nad přechodem na Fedoru.Teď používám Windows XP,na net se připojuju přes GPRS a T-mobile comunication centre,který mi vytvořil připojení k netu.Ptal jsem se u T-mobile,jsetli mají něco takového i pro Linux,řekli,že nemají.Budu to připojení muset nastavit ručně???Budou kolem toho problémy???Dík za radu.

Ahoj, GPRS pouzivam take a rozdil oproti win je jenom v tom, ze pod Linuxem to nepada a funguje bez problemu, nastaveni najdes na http://www.linuxsoft.cz/article.php?id_article=152

Dobrý den,
rád bych se zeptal, zda máte někdo zkušenosti se zprovozněním karty OPTION GT Combo EDGE od T-mobile. Velmi bych přivítal nějaký odkaz / návod podle kterého bych mohl kartu rozchodit. (Používám notebook Prestigio). Děkuji za pomoc.

Zdravim,

Pred chvili jsem ji (OPTION GT Combo EDGE od T-mobile) strcil do notasu a on chudak vytuhl, pri naslednem bootovani se Fedora 8 zasekla pri spousteni HALu. Pomohlo vypnuti. Dostal jste se nekdo dal?

Dik

Kdyz jsem ve Fedora 8 stopnul HAL a strcil kartu do notasu uz nevytuhl. Byl jsem schopen overit, ze ji system vidi pomoci lspcmcia pripadne lspci. Jakmile jsem ale zkusil comgt opet nastalo vytuhnuti systemu a po vytazeni karty se system sam restaroval.

Po upgrade na Fedora 9 jiz tyto problemy nenastavaji. Rozbehnout wifi na te PCMCIA karte bylo snadne, ale kvuli tomu ji nemam. Pri pokusu o spusteni ovladaci utility k dane krate (comgt) mi to stale hazi tuto chybu:

#comgt -x -d /dev/ttyS0
High speed overide (115200 is now 57600).
SIM ERROR
Check device port configuration.
Check SIM is inserted
Test SIM in a mobile phone?

SIMka je dobra (vyzkouseno), port mam take spravne viz vypis z dmesg:

pccard: CardBus card inserted into slot 0
PCI: Enabling device 0000:16:00.1 (0000 -> 0001)
ACPI: PCI Interrupt 0000:16:00.1[A] -> GSI 16 (level, low) -> IRQ 16
0000:16:00.1: ttyS0 at I/O 0x8000 (irq = 16) is a 16550A
PCI: Enabling device 0000:16:00.0 (0000 -> 0002)
ACPI: PCI Interrupt 0000:16:00.0[A] -> GSI 16 (level, low) -> IRQ 16
PCI: Setting latency timer of device 0000:16:00.0 to 64
ssb: Sonics Silicon Backplane found on PCI device 0000:16:00.0
b43-phy1: Broadcom 4306 WLAN found
b43-phy1 debug: Found PHY: Analog 2, Type 2, Revision 2
b43-phy1 debug: Found Radio: Manuf 0x17F, Version 0x2050, Revision 2
phy1: Selected rate control algorithm ‘pid’
Broadcom 43xx driver loaded [ Features: PMLR, Firmware-ID: FW13 ]

Zkus nastavit rychlost portu na nizsi. Nemam s tim absolutne zadne zkusenosti, jen me to napadlo kdyz vidim tu hlasku High speed override.

To prave dela ten prepinac =x, protoze karta pry nezvlada 115200baudu. Bez =x se to chova stejne.

Nasel sem nejake info, kde lide s Ubuntu popisuji uplne stejny problem a pomohlo jim dat libusual do blacklistu. Kdyz si ale u sebe zkusim vypsat co mam v jadre za moduly (lsmod), zadny libusual tam neni. Je ve Fedore nejaka alternativa?

Dival jsem se jeste, ze karta pouziva IRQ16:

PCI: Enabling device 0000:16:00.1 (0000 -> 0001)
ACPI: PCI Interrupt 0000:16:00.1[A] -> GSI 16 (level, low) -> IRQ 16
0000:16:00.1: ttyS0 at I/O 0x8000 (irq = 16) is a 16550A

Na 16ce mam uz ale i jine veci:

#cat /proc/interrupts | grep 16:
16: 2470 244786 IO-APIC-fasteoi yenta, uhci_hcd:usb5, ahci

nemuze toto zpusobovat problemy?

Ve Fedora neni libusual vubec zkompilovany (lze overit v /boot/config- - hledej libusual). Sdileni IRQ muze delat problemy, u sitovych karet uz jsem se s tim setkal, ale nevim zda takovehoto razu. Vyzkouset to muzes tak, ze v BIOSu vypnes USB. Yenta je ovladac pcmcia, takze ten asi budes potrebovat.

Ten comgt je celkem zajimavy: http://www.pharscape.org/content/view/46/70/
zkus to pustit jeste s parametrem -v, melo by to vypsat vic informaci.
Mas na simce pin nebo ne?

S parametrem -v to nejprve vypise samo sebe (skript) a pak toto:
[i]
comgt 14:58:09 -> @0000 opengt
comgt 14:58:09 -> Opened /dev/ttyS0 as FD 3
comgt 14:58:09 -> @0011 set com 115200n81
comgt 14:58:09 -> @0033 set senddelay 0.05
comgt 14:58:09 -> @0056 send “AT+CFUN=1^m”
comgt 14:58:10 -> @0079 waitquiet 1 0.2

comgt 14:58:10 -> @0097 :start
comgt 14:58:10 -> @0108 flash 0.1
comgt 14:58:10 -> @0122 send “AT+CPIN?^m”
comgt 14:58:10 -> @0144 waitfor 30 “SIM PUK”,“SIM PIN”,“READY”,“ERROR”,“ERR”
comgt 14:58:40 -> @0201 if % = -1 goto error
comgt 14:58:40 -> @0211 goto error
comgt 14:58:40 -> @0345 :error
comgt 14:58:40 -> @0356 print $s," SIM ERROR
SIM ERROR
comgt 14:58:40 -> @0389 print "Check device port configuration.
Check device port configuration.
Check SIM is inserted
Test SIM in a mobile phone?
comgt 14:58:40 -> @0485 exit 1
[/i]
Tzn. ze je modem vraci kod -1.
Ve skriptu je pritom 6 moznosti z toho 3 jsou chyby a 3 ok:

10@0197 if % = -1 goto error
11@0222 if % = 0 goto ready
12@0246 if % = 1 goto getpin
13@0271 if % = 2 goto ready
14@0295 if % = 3 goto error
15@0319 if % = 4 goto error

Na SIMce PIN neni.

Pri dalsim restartu se zkusim jeste pohrabat v BIOSu.

Prisel jsem jeste na zvlastni vec pccardctl ident vraci toto:

Socket 0:
no product info available

A pritom jsem kdesi na forech videl, ze by to melo vracet zhruba toto:

Socket 0:
product info: “GlobeTrotter”, “EDGE”, “ML2132C2”, “”
manfid: 0x0314, 0x0007
function: 2 (serial)

Jeste sem zkusil wvdial a sice to pise toto:

–> WvDial: Internet dialer version 1.60
–> Initializing modem.
–> Sending: ATZ
–> Sending: ATQ0
–> Re-Sending: ATZ
–> Modem not responding.

… ale LED diodka na karte zacne blikat tak, ze zablika 2x po 2s, tzn. treti moznost z:

Flash once every second - PC Card is powered on but not registered on the network
Flash once every two seconds - PC Card is powered on and registered on the network
Flash twice every two seconds - PC Card is powered on, registered on the network and GPRS is available.

(popis od vyrobce)
Jinak blika ta prvni varianta po vlozeni do notasu.
Kazdopadne se to nepripoji :frowning:

Nevim, jediny co by me znervoznovalo je ten pccardctl ident. Otazka je, zda v te karte skutecne je “GlobeTrotter” a ne neco jineho. Zkousels kartu jinde jesli gprs modem funguje? Pripadne holt zkus jinou distribuci…

Jen tak ze zvedavosti jsem po nekolika mesicich zkusil opet wvdial a nestacim se divit. Pripojeni funguje!

Chtel jsem se podelit o svuj wvdial.conf a koukam ze po vyndani pcmcia karty je v /etc nejaky defaultni konfigurak a ten muj je pryc :frowning: Co by mi ho mohlo mazat?
Ted abych to odladil znova a zrusil pravo zapisu i vlastnikoj :slight_smile:

nemuzes sem hodit jak vypada tvuj wvdal.conf?

zkusil sem PCMCIA 4G kartu pouzit v Gnome PPP a:

–> Ignoring malformed input line: “;Do NOT edit this file by hand!”
–> WvDial: Internet dialer version 1.60
–> Initializing modem.
–> Sending: ATZ
ATZ
OK
–> Sending: AT+CGDCONT=1,“PPP”,“internet.t-mobile.cz”,“0,0”,0,0
AT+CGDCONT=1,“PPP”,“internet.t-mobile.cz”,“0,0”,0,0
OK
–> Found a good menu option: “1”.
–> Modem initialized.
–> Sending: ATM1L3DT99#
–> Waiting for carrier.
ATM1L3DT
99#
AUTHENTICATION FAILURE

nevite v cem by mohla byt chyba

[Dialer Defaults]
Baud = 57600
Modem = /dev/ttyS0
Dial Command = ATD
Carrier Check = no

[Dialer Setup]
Init = AT+CFUN=1

[Dialer Status]
Init1 = AT+COPS?;+CSQ

[Dialer GPRS]
Init = AT+CGDCONT=1,“IP”,“internet.t-mobile.cz”
Phone = 99**1#
Username = gprs
Password = gprs